I'm migrating to OpenTasks from another Tasks/ToDo app called aCalendar Tasks which would sync with Google. I need to change because only the local Tasks app on my smartphone supports time-based due dates [0]. Time fields don't map to Google Tasks, & as such I'm unable to sync the time field to Thunderbird/Lightning on my computer.
I've installed the DAVDroid app which works with my FastMail account's CalDAV/CardDAV sync, & it specified that I use OpenTasks to be able to sync Tasks/ToDos.
On Android each task will notify upon start time & due time. However on Thunderbird/Lightning there's no reminder at all. I have to manually edit each & set the Reminder field to 0 minutes [1] which then enables a 'start' time reminder- still not at 'due', which is tolerable.
The following are fields DAVDroid syncs between the OpenTasks app, & the Tasks section of Thunderbird/Lightning:
UID
SUMMARY, DESCRIPTION
LOCATION
GEO
URL
ORGANIZER
PRIORITY
COMPLETED, PERCENT-COMPLETE
STATUS
CREATED, LAST-MODIFIED
DTSTART, DUE, DURATION
RDATE, EXDATE, RRULE
Since there's no explicitly defined 'Reminder' field here, is there a way to make Lightning apply reminders based on any of these fields?
